Ebreichsdorf no longer dreams: Como City withdraws ESC application!
Ebreichsdorf's hopes of hosting the Eurovision Song Contest in 2026 are finally gone. The local Comer City has officially withdrawn its application to host the popular music event. Managing Director Siegmund Kahlbacher confirmed that the proposal will not advance to the next selection round. Despite financial support from Irish real estate tycoon Luke Comer, the bureaucracy and tight time frame were simply too much. This means that the dreams and plans to develop Ebreichsdorf into a dynamic “music metropolis” have failed for the time being eurovisionfun.com reported.
The ambitious plans included the construction of a temporary concert site with space for up to 20,000 spectators and additional space for up to 30,000 people for public broadcasting. A fully equipped press center for 1,500 media representatives should not be missing. The former Magna Racino was chosen as the ideal venue, but the regulations of the public broadcaster ORF required an official application from the municipality of Ebreichsdorf. Private investments, unless approved by the municipality, were not permitted.
Complex application hurdles
The decision did not come as a surprise, as Ebreichsdorf's chances were considered slim from the start. Strong competitors such as Vienna, Innsbruck and St. Pölten have a more robust infrastructure and are once again proving themselves to be important players in the selection process. Innsbruck has already received the “green light” for its application, while other cities are also in the final stages of finalizing their concepts oe24.at determines.
Kahlbacher admitted that the reality of hosting an event of this magnitude was far more complicated than originally imagined. Although he showed understanding for the situation, there remains disappointment about the project's premature end. “We had hoped to present the advantages of the region and involve the community,” said Kahlbacher.
